As a Power Delivery & System Validation Engineer , you will play a critical role in the validation of Intel’s next‑generation high‑performance CPUs and system‑level interconnected interfaces. This position is responsible for ensuring that complex, cutting‑edge processor architectures meet stringent power, performance, and reliability requirements before they reach customers. You will work cross‑functionally with architecture, design, and engineering teams to identify, develop, and execute worst‑case stress validation scenarios at the system level. Your contributions will directly impact product readiness and help ensure robust behavior under real‑world workloads and extreme operating conditions. Key Responsibilities Perform system‑level validation on Intel’s next‑generation high‑performance CPUs and interconnected subsystems. Perform power delivery validation for complex systems, including CPUs, SoCs, and platform components. Identify, model, and implement worst‑case stress scenarios to thoroughly exercise CPU power, performance, and reliability boundaries. Develop and execute validation strategies, test plans, and stress workloads targeted at exposing system integration issues. Analyze system behavior under extreme conditions to root‑cause defects and contribute to design or firmware fixes. Collaborate with cross‑disciplinary engineering teams (architecture, silicon design, firmware, power management) to ensure comprehensive validation coverage. Utilize system‑level debug tools, performance analyzers, and power measurement instrumentation. Drive continuous improvement of validation methodologies, tools, and automation frameworks.
